Résumé

This pocketbook is a complete essential guide to the medical, cultural, and economic revolution sparked by gl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) drugs. Written in everyday language, we explore how medications once designed for diabetes became the most promising weight-loss tools in the world, and why their impact may extend far beyond obesity. The book begins with the long history of failed diet promises, from crash diets and stimulants to low-carb fads and meal-replacement plans.
It then explains why gl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onists are different. Rather than relying on willpower or stimulants, these drugs mimic a natural gut hormone that helps regulate blood sugar, slow digestion, increase fullness, and reduce appetite through the body's own metabolic signaling system. The book also explores the enormous disruption created by these drugs. We explore how Ozempic, Wegovy, Mounjaro, and related treatments have transformed the pharmaceutical industry, overwhelmed supply chains, reshaped telemedicine, and forced traditional weight-loss companies, gyms, food brands, clothing retailers, cosmetic clinics, and even airlines to adapt.
At the same time, there are controversies: high prices, insurance barriers, shortages for diabetic patients, side effects, long-term uncertainty, and the risk of weight regain after stopping treatment. The book explains how gl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) drugs may improve cardiovascular health, reduce inflammation, protect kidney and liver function, and possibly influence conditions tied to the brain, addiction, mood, and neurodegeneration.
What began as a treatment for blood sugar has become a window into metabolism as a central driver of chronic disease. Finally, the book ends with where this revolution goes next. We explore oral formulations, dual and triple agonists, generics, preventive medicine, longevity research, and the ethical question of who gets access if these drugs truly reshape the future of health. It ends with a clear tension: gl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) drugs may become one of the great medical breakthroughs of our time, but only if science, safety, affordability, and fairness can keep pace with the hype.
